If you’ve just started exercises, but are capable of running 5Ks already, then you’ll most likely put too much stress on your body by doing it daily. Your body is simply not adjusted to the load yet and depriving it of the most needed rest would just be a recipe for disaster. About a year ago I started running again. It had been 6 years since I had run for the first time, so I thought I could just pick up where I left, which was daily. But it quickly became evident I wasn’t in the same shape anymore – before I could easily run 5Ks, now I could barely run 2–3Ks, but I still ran daily. About 1½ week in, my legs started to hurt, but it disappeared quickly again. 2 weeks in, it got worse and stayed for longer, but at week 3½ everything came crashing down.
